The 2010 Pirelli Calendar was captured by American photographer Terry Richardson
Cultural & Ethical Considerations
The 36th edition of the calendar was entrusted to Terry Richardson, a photographer renowned for his snapshot aesthetic and the ability to break down the "fourth wall" between subject and viewer. At the time of its release, Richardson’s style was a polarizing force in the fashion industry; he favored harsh direct flash, overexposed lighting, and a raw, almost amateurish presentation that stood in sharp contrast to the polished, high-gloss perfection typical of luxury brands.
